What was the storage capacity of the first commercially available hard drive?
5 MB
Background
The world's first hard drive stored just 5 MB of data. It came from IBM in 1956 and was called the RAMAC 305. The machine was as big as two fridges and weighed over a ton. Today a tiny USB stick holds millions of times more.
